Key Features of Stamps Icons
- High Quality Design: Each icon is created with attention to detail, ensuring a polished and professional appearance.
- 100% Vector Format: The use of vector graphics allows for unlimited scalability without loss of quality.
- 100% Customizable: Users can adjust colors, stroke weights, and other attributes to match their brand or project requirements.
- Editable Stroke: The ability to modify stroke weight gives greater control over the visual impact of each icon.
- Easy Drag and Drop: The files are designed for seamless integration into design workflows.
- Files Included: The package contains source files in Adobe Illustrator (Ai), EPS Version 10, SVG, PNG with transparency, and a Readme.txt guide.
